Increasing need for the best quality service and the need to offer IT infrastructure management from a remote location are expected to drive the RIM market

The market is growing rapidly due to increasing digitalization and the need to expand the IT infrastructure to support the increasing business functions and customer base. Varied pricing for services is restraining the market growth.

IT and telecommunication vertical is expected to hold the largest market share during the forecast period

All organizations across verticals are outsourcing their IT infrastructure services to concentrate on their business functions more effectively. This vertical hosts some of the largest global technology players, and majority of organizations in this vertical are global or have IT infrastructures based at different locations. RIM offers a centralized model to manage and monitor the scattered infrastructure to secure it and manage its performance. This is the major factor that is increasing the demand for RIM services among enterprises so that they can offer the best experience to their customers and increase their revenue.

APAC provides attractive growth opportunities and is expected to grow at the highest CAGR

Asia Pacific (APAC) offers great growth opportunities. The foremost factors driving the growth in this region are the increasing competition among enterprises to expand and the growing consumption of cloud services.

Additionally, the rising digitalization among major verticals is also one of the reasons for this growth. APAC holds significant potential for the adoption of RIM solutions due to the growing IT infrastructure and organizations expanding their bases across locations. The government has also taken initiatives to make the countries digital; for instance, India is becoming Digital India as per the government directives, and this is leading to the high growth rate in the APAC region.

Research Coverage:

The market is segmented by core service, deployment type, organization size, vertical, and region. The core service segment includes database management, storage management, server management, network and communication management, desktop management, application management, and others (website management, compliance management, and security management). The deployment type covers cloud and on-premises deployments. The organization size segment comprises Small and Medium-sized Businesses (SMBs) and large enterprises. The verticals considered for the report comprise Banking, Financial Services, and Insurance (BFSI); retail and eCommerce; healthcare; transportation; IT and telecommunication; media and entertainment; manufacturing; government and defense; and other verticals. Other verticals cover utilities, education, and travel and hospitality. The regional analysis includes the study of North America, Europe, APAC, Middle East and Africa (MEA), and Latin America.
